Fixing Common Issues with Your Your X2D Auto Combo
Experiencing setbacks with your Bambu Lab X2D AMS unit? Don't panic! Many people encounter occasional problems during operation. A frequent issue is plastic clogging in the print head ; try a cold pull or bumping the nozzle temperature. Another problem might be poor bed grip, which you can address by calibrating the bed, scrubbing the print surface , or applying a bed adhesive . Lastly , be sure to verify your firmware is current version, as this often fixes many unexpected malfunctions.
